文化背景
In Tehran, driving is considered a test of character. The phrase often implies navigating heavy traffic and 'Zereh-pushi' (wearing armor) metaphorically. In rural areas, 'mashin ranandegi kardan' often refers to driving pickup trucks (Zamyad) or tractors, and is a vital economic skill. For Iranians abroad, getting a local license is a major milestone of integration, often discussed using this phrase. Younger Iranians use 'Dor-dor' to describe driving around aimlessly to socialize, which is a specific type of 'ranandegi'.
Drop the 'Mashin'
In 90% of conversations, you can just say 'ranandegi kardan'. Everyone knows you mean a car.
Watch the Tense
Don't forget the 'mi-' prefix for present tense. 'Mashin ranandegi konam' is subjunctive; 'mikonam' is indicative.

The Horn
In Iran, 'ranandegi' involves using the horn to say 'hello', 'watch out', or 'thank you'. It's not always aggressive!
